Overview
- Kirill Kaprizov won it for Minnesota with a power-play one-timer at 4:50 of overtime in a 3-2 Wild victory in St. Paul.
- Pavel Dorofeyev and Reilly Smith scored power-play goals for Vegas, which had all four OT shots go against it.
- Rookie goalie Carl Lindbom made 24 saves for the Golden Knights and dropped to 0-3-2 in his first five NHL starts.
- One night earlier, Vegas halted a four-game slide with a 4-1 win in St. Louis as rookie Braeden Bowman recorded his first NHL goal and assist.
- Akira Schmid stopped 22 shots against the Blues, while injuries to Adin Hill, William Karlsson and Mark Stone continued to shape lineup and goaltending choices.
